Other Event |
25 Dec 1175 |
Abergavenny Castle, Monmouthshire, Wales |
William de Braose carried out the Abergavenny Massacre, luring three Welsh princes and other Welsh leaders to their deaths. |

Death |
09 Aug 1211 |
Corbeil, Kingdom of France |
He died in exile after he fell out of favor with King John of England. |
